How do you find the geometric mean?
Geometric mean is calculated for sets of positive real numbers. This is calculated by multiplying all the numbers (call the number of numbers n), and taking the nth root of the total. Geometric Mean is used in the case when finding an average for set of numbers presented as percentages.
What is the geometric mean of a 4×16 rectangle?
The arithmetic mean of 4 and 16 is 10, and a square with a side of 10 will have the same perimeter as one with sides 4 and 16. Now, if we take the area of our 4 x 16 rectangle instead, it is the product of 4 and 16 and equals 64. The geometric mean answers the question: what side should a square have so that its area is 64?
What is the difference between arithmetic average and geometric mean?
Geometric mean is a kind of average of a set of numbers that is different from the arithmetic average. Geometric mean is calculated for sets of positive real numbers. This is calculated by multiplying all the numbers (call the number of numbers n), and taking the nth root of the total.
